Output 039451a8dd3b7109464c85858fcc44334c4aaf27ae218dfa1b1939e0709fbcc7:3

value
87565674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c223ab65ce97c1516d59241622d10657db997a4 OP_EQUAL
address
MEqibJhHKuqzC6fEQqZS2Xu4o9Gst3nv4k
transaction
039451a8dd3b7109464c85858fcc44334c4aaf27ae218dfa1b1939e0709fbcc7
spent
true